Technical Business Analyst – Customer Journey
Hybrid Working – Edinburgh OR London – 2 days a week on site.
Financial Services
Lorien's leading banking client is looking for a Technical Business Analyst with a strong focus on customer journey optimisation to bridge the gap between business and technology.
Working across multiple franchises, functions, and organisations, you will gather and translate business and customer requirements into clear, deliverable technical solutions that enhance the end-to-end customer experience.
The ideal candidate has a background in High Street Banking, passionate about improving customer experiences through technology. You have experience working across business and technology teams, understand the complexities of retail banking customer journeys, and can translate business needs into structured, prioritised work that enables Agile delivery teams to deliver high-quality, customer-focused solutions.

Key Responsibilities
- Analyse and improve end-to-end customer journeys, identifying opportunities to enhance customer experience and business outcomes.
- Engage with business stakeholders to gather, analyse, and document business, customer, and technical requirements.
- Translate requirements into user stories, acceptance criteria, and prioritised deliverables for Agile teams.
- Work closely with Product Owners, Delivery Leads, Architects, and Engineering teams to ensure solutions are delivered to agreed time, cost, and quality.
- Capture and manage technical and non-technical requirements using Jira, maintaining Agile backlogs and delivery queues.
- Facilitate workshops to uncover customer needs, business processes, and future-state solutions.
- Ensure requirements remain aligned to business priorities throughout the delivery lifecycle.
- Support continuous improvement by refining customer journeys, business processes, and delivery practices.
Skills & Experience
- Proven experience as a Technical Business Analyst in Agile environments.
- Demonstrable experience working within High Street/Retail Banking is essential.
- Strong understanding of retail banking products, customer journeys, and digital transformation initiatives.
- Strong experience in customer journey mapping, business analysis, and requirements gathering.
- Ability to translate business needs into clear technical requirements and deliverable work packages.
- Hands-on experience with Jira, Agile backlogs, and user story management.
- Excellent stakeholder management and communication skills, with the ability to work across business and technology teams.
- Strong analytical and problem-solving skills with a focus on delivering customer-centric solutions.
